Job Summary:

The Planning and Project Management group at Vail Resorts is responsible for the management of strategic, high-risk capital projects across our portfolio of resorts globally. These projects include the planning and construction of a variety of projects including but not limited to: new restaurants, new lifts, snow making expansions, employee housing and base area and on-mountain improvements. The Senior Financial Analyst will be responsible for tracking project budgets and providing process controls leadership to the team. The Analyst will report to the Principal Financial Analyst and provides business assistance to the Planning and Project Management Team.

Job Responsibilities:

Drive change and improvements in financial controls, processes, and reporting

Support and guide capital project budgeting and forecasting

Maintain regular project budget tracking data and deliver project budget reporting

Communicate effectively with team members, leaders, cross functional contacts, and external partners

Collaborate with internal fixed assets, general ledger, accounts payable, tax and technical accounting, and legal teams

Audit and reconcile vendor contracts and budget activity ad hoc

Own month end close labor allocations, re-class entries, and invoice accruals

Investigate and navigate ambiguous ad hoc situations and create path forward and process where needed

Be flexible to adapt to evolving scope of responsibilities

Job Qualifications:

Bachelor’s degree in accounting, finance, data analytics or related field is preferred

1 to 3 years of experience in accounting, finance, project management, project controls, data management, business systems and analysis, or related field is preferred

Strong Microsoft Excel skills are essential

Strong ability to learn and navigate new systems is required

Experience with Smarsheets is a plus

Experience with Alteryx, Tableau, Power BI, and other similar tools is a plus

Experience with Enterprise Asset Management system and implementation is a plus

Knowledge of PeopleSoft Financials system, Conga (contract management software), and Coupa (purchasing software) is helpful but not required. Ability to learn and navigate new systems is required

Required Professional Characteristics:

Proven success and initiative to create and improve processes and reporting insights

Proven ability to work in a dynamic and changing environment and flexibility to multi-task

Self-starter with a strong att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and drive for excellence

Excellent communication skills and ability to build strong cross-functional partnerships

The expected Total Compensation for this role is $67,000 - $92,000- + annual bonus. Individual compensation decisions are based on a variety of factors.
